Check out all videos featuring Baby Myrtle in her own dedicated playlist here: • Baby Orangutan Myrtle at Chester Zoo Videos Myrtle was born on 31st August 2023 to Mother Sarikei and Father Willie Sarikei is an experienced mother orangutan who has had previous offspring including her son Tombol who lives with her and the rest of the Bornean Orangutans at Chester Zoo endangered newborn baby orangutan Chester Zoo Baby Orangutan Chester Zoo is has a very successful record of Orangutan births at the zoo and most of the Orangutan Mothers are able to rear their own young without the assistance of zoo staff, this is largely due to the expert care and facilities the World Class Zoo provides for the animals. The current animal population have had valuable experience with babies and have observed relatives caring for young, using this learning and experience to enable them to rear their own offspring Birth of critically endangered orangutan at Chester Zoo Bornean Orangutans have been considered critically endangered since 2016 with an only an estimated 100,000 left in the wild.
